My current implementation is loadbalancing Tor Relay traffic, which provides high availability and economies of scale using existing, cost-effective, bare metal nodes. The same approach could be extrapolated to cost-effective, virtual nodes to a similar benefit.
I suppose the real question is the cost-benefit of deploying to multiple public addresses vs single addresses in a location? I assume that answer is dependent on resource availability and/or the needs of the Tor network (e.g., the recent need for new Tor bridges).
Whichever the situation, it's nice to know there are multiple solutions to Tor.

I am currently not performing any load-balancing between my different Tor relays or my physical/virtual servers. Having thought about it a bit, I can only see this make sense if you intend to offer .onion services. I don't. Maybe I missed something?

I have some bare-metal servers that run multiple instances of Tor to provide multiple relays each and I have some virtual instances (KVM, VMWare) that run a single instance of Tor, providing one relay each. These are hosted at different providers all over the world (see simplified attached graphic).

As each relay is measured by the Tor network individually, is reachable independently and is not "critical" to the rest of the network, I don't see how load-balancing them could give me or the users of Tor a sizable benefit - as long as I am not running any hidden services. If one relay goes down, there is already an automatic switch-over to a different relay in the network. If one relay is overloaded, this is also detected and (presumably) it will be used less in the future.

My name is Kristian, I am based in Europe, and I operate all nodes behind the domain lokodlare.com. “Lökodlare” is Swedish for “onion farmers”, which is pretty much what I do.

My goal is to contribute to the Tor network by providing a couple of high-bandwidth nodes all over the globe, preferably at less common providers and/or in niche countries. I will focus on Middle and Guard relays, though I will throw some exits into the mix every now and then with a very reduced exit policy.

I currently operate 90+ relays and bridges with a theoretical bandwidth capacity of roughly 25 Gbit/s. As a snapshot, those nodes handled around 280 TB of Tor-related traffic in the past 24 hours.
